Fulton Avenue Drawbridge Will Close Through March

Effective Friday, January 31 at 10 a.m. and continuing until Friday, March 28, the Fulton Avenue Drawbridge between Secor Lane and Edison Avenue in Mount Vernon and Pelham Manor will be closed to vehicular traffic.  Short term closures of the bridge to pedestrian traffic will be required periodically throughout the project.

This closure is necessary to correct structural deficiencies detected by inspectors. A large scale rehabilitation project is currently being designed to eliminate the need for the interim repairs of the last several years.

The Fulton Avenue Bridge connects Mount Vernon to Rt. 1 in addition to the area’s major retail corridor. The posted detour route uses Pelham Parkway to Boston Post Road to Provost Avenue to South Third Avenue to South Columbus Avenue to South Fulton Avenue.
